Container Plant Sizes
Container sizes indicate plant age and growing capacity rather than liquid volume equivalents. Our containers follow industry-standard nursery "trade gallon" specifications, which differ from standard liquid gallon measurements.

Bare Root Plants
Bare root plants are sold by height from the root system to the top of the plant. Plants may exceed minimum height requirements.
Common Sizes:
- Trees: 1 foot, 2 feet, 3 feet, 4 feet, 5 feet, 6 feet
- Shrubs & Perennials: 1 foot, 18 inches, 2 feet

#ProPlantTips for Care:
Plant Golden Falls® Redbud in either full sun or partial shade with at least four hours of light a day. Keep them evenly moist with a regular schedule of supplemental water, especially in dry weather. Redbuds will do best in a planting site with rich soil that drains well after a rainfall. Add a three-inch layer of pine bark mulch spread out to several feet past the canopy. Use symbiotic Nature Hills Root Booster in the planting hole for life-long support that never "wears out". You'll rarely need to prune this slender selection. Prune to shape after the spring flowers are finished for the season.
